List and sell. 5. … WebOct 14, 2024 · The act of selling a home with a reverse mortgage is typically triggered by what lenders call a maturity event. Anytime a maturity event is reached, your reverse mortgage comes due. You can trigger a maturity event yourself . Or a maturity event might be reached automatically, due to the homeowners death or illness.

WebAug 28, 2024 · A reverse mortgage loan is “non-recourse”, meaning that if you sell the home to repay the loan, you will never owe more than the loan balance or the value of the property, whichever is less; and no assets other than the home must be used to repay the debt.
